> +LEAF(safe_syscall_base)
> + .cfi_startproc
> +#if _MIPS_SIM == _ABIO32
> + /*
> + * The syscall calling convention is nearly the same as C:
> + * we enter with a0 == &signal_pending
> + * a1 == syscall number
> + * a2, a3, stack == syscall arguments
> + * and return the result in a0
> + * and the syscall instruction needs
> + * v0 == syscall number
> + * a0 ... a3, stack == syscall arguments
> + * and returns the result in v0
> + * Shuffle everything around appropriately.
> + */
> + move t0, a0 /* signal_pending pointer */
> + move v0, a1 /* syscall number */
> + move a0, a2 /* syscall arguments */
> + move a1, a3
> + lw a2, 16(sp)
> + lw a3, 20(sp)
> + lw t4, 24(sp)
> + lw t5, 28(sp)
> + lw t6, 32(sp)
> + lw t7, 40(sp)
> + sw t4, 16(sp)
> + sw t5, 20(sp)
> + sw t6, 24(sp)
> + sw t7, 28(sp)
This is a varargs call, so (unless I'm confused, which is
quite possible) the caller will only allocate enough stack
space for the arguments we're actually passed, right? That
means that unless the syscall actually has 3 or more arguments
the memory at 16(sp) will be whatever the caller had on the
stack above the argument-passing area, and we can't write to
it. I think we need to actually move sp down here so we have
some space we know we can scribble on.
